## Run DELTAR
### Installation
```bash
conda create --name deltar --file requirements.txt
```
### Prepare the data and pretrained model
Download from the above link, and place the data and model as below:
```
deltar
├── data
│ ├── demo
│ └── ZJUL5
└── weights
└── nyu.pt
```
### Evaluate on ZJUL5 dataset
```bash
python evaluate.py configs/test_zjuL5.txt
```
### Run the demo
```bash
python evaluate.py configs/test_demo.txt
python scripts/make_gif.py --data_folder data/demo/room --pred_folder tmp/room
```
